The USA has imposed the first sanctions against Russia

According to inkorr.com: President Donald Trump announced the introduction of new sanctions that will affect major Russian oil and gas companies, including 'Rosneft' and 'Lukoil'. This decision was a response to the cancellation of a planned summit with Russian President Vladimir Putin, which was supposed to take place in Budapest.

'The time has come', - stated Trump.

U.S. Secretary of State Marco Rubio supported the introduction of sanctions, noting that Russia is not taking any serious steps to change its position regarding the war in Ukraine. He also canceled a planned meeting with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ov, as it became clear during a phone call that the Kremlin was avoiding discussions on a ceasefire.

Rubio and his strategic approach

Secretary of State Rubio advocates a tough policy towards Moscow, unlike the President's Special Envoy Stephen Witkoff, who takes a more compromise-oriented approach. Rubio's position has been key in the process of imposing sanctions against Russia.

'President Trump always leads foreign policy, and his team is united in implementing the vision of America First', - noted the White House press secretary.

New assessments of relations with Moscow

The meeting in August demonstrated tensions in U.S.-Russia relations due to Putin's demands regarding Ukrainian territories. This time, Rubio took charge of preparing for dialogue, which led to the imposition of sanctions.

Sanctions and possible further actions

Despite the imposed restrictions, Secretary of State Rubio did not rule out the possibility of contacts with Moscow, emphasizing readiness for dialogue to achieve peace. Trump also noted that negotiations may be necessary if no progress is made.

The cancellation of the summit between Trump and Putin in Budapest became a catalyst for the imposition of sanctions, which are primarily aimed at the Russian oil and gas sector. Relations between the USA and Russia remain complex and tense, and the further steps of both countries are still uncertain.
